Trying the Natural Vita Mask
Trying the Natural Vita Mask Too Cool For School sent to me. At first, I didn’t think it was going to like it due to it being slimy and looking like it was going to be way to big for my face, however after trying it, I changed my mind.
It was a little big on my face, but not like how some masks are which is amazing. One of my biggest pet peeves is when a sheet mask is just way to big. The smell of the mask, smells exactly like lemon, which is very refreshing. After using, I made sure to rub/pat the excess product in, and I can definitely tell a difference in how bright my skin is.

To get the most out of your Natural Vita Mask (or any sheet mask, really!), here are a few tips I've picked up. First, always cleanse your face thoroughly before applying. Some people even like to use a toner first to balance their skin's pH. Second, don't just toss the mask once you're done! There's usually a lot of extra serum left in the packet, which you can pat onto your neck, décolletage, and even your hands for extra hydration. Finally, after removing the mask, gently pat the remaining essence into your skin until fully absorbed. Don't rinse it off! Follow up with your moisturizer to seal in all the benefits. I usually use a sheet mask once or twice a week, or whenever my skin feels like it needs an extra boost – perhaps before a special event or after a long, tiring week.
